1.D.G co. has an average gross sales of 37 million per week from their products in all outlets with a standard deviation of 6 million. An area manager found out that the average gross sales from the 32 outlets under his area is 34.8 million per week. Is the mean sales of the products in 32 branches significantly different from the mean sales in all outlets? Use ∝ = 5%
